Revel in refined luxury at JW Marriott Essex House New York. Our upscale Central Park South hotel in New York City sits adjacent to Central Park. It is minutes from Lincoln Center, Columbus Circle, Fifth Avenue, and numerous other NYC attractions. Inside our recently redesigned hotel in Manhattan, every room and suite boasts Art Deco design elements, plush bedding, and marble bathrooms. Spacious family connector rooms benefit from expanded living areas, and suites with terraces overlooking Central Park are available, as are pet-friendly accommodations. Rejuvenate at PRIMP spa, break a sweat at our fitness center or enjoy fine dining at our SOUTHGATE Bar & Restaurant before exploring the city. Experience the recently redesigned spaces and luxury amenities at JW Marriott Essex House New York.

This place feels like a self service apt than an iconic 5 star hotel. There is no water, no kettle/coffee maker in the room. We had to pick up water bottles everyday from the reception. After repeatedly asking for a kettle, they brought one but it was disgusting so I had to ask for hot water daily. If you don’t pay for a high floor Central Park view room, the chance of them giving you a generous upgrade is close to zero. They made it clear to us that they get a lot of ambassadors and titanium members, and there is only limited rooms for Marriott status upgrade. So work your totem pole. I would recommend bring your money and status else where, you might get a much better view room. One of the managers was nice enough to give us one category upgrade for titanium membership, the family suite was comfy in terms of the size, nothing luxurious. But seriously with no view, there is no point of staying in this location unless you think you are in love w the Central Park. The good restaurants and interesting scenes are mostly downtown. Lastly, the executive lounge is a joke, no window, the free breakfast is a 3 star max, not even a glass cup for your cappuccino. You have to pay to sit in their Southgate restaurant for the same breakfast. The only worthy pic of the hotel is the entrance flower bouquet and the chandelier hallway, there is no other interesting common area to enjoy yourself which is very much a design mistake. If you are used to Marriott JW Asian and Middle Eastern standards or even European 5 star standards, this hotel apart from its iconic status and location deserves a 3.5 star max. Of course they attribute the lack of service to Covid. The employees are overworked, often they mentioned they had to do 2-3 people’s jobs for the pay of one due to lack of workers. I feel for you, but if you are charging the rate you are charging, your clients expect a certain level of service.

My husband and I booked a night here at the JW Marriott Essex House, as our go to Marriott hotels, the St Regis and Ritz Carlton are currently closed. We drove our car to the hotel and valeted it. While we reside in NYC, I am initially from the Midwest, and therefore, my photo ID reflects that. The hotel associate asked me for the airport paperwork that must be filled out when visiting NY and I told her that I live in NY and therefore do not have paperwork. She accepted my response and promptly checked us in and even gave us late check out at 1 PM. We then rode up the elevator to our room. We walked into our room and found the bed covered in about 50 throw pillows and numerous stacked ice buckets and trays piled on the desk. I called down to the front desk to ask for a room change, as it seemed that we were accidentally given a room used for storage. An associate met us at our room with a new key for a new room on the same floor. I was secretly hoping for an upgrade at this point since the initial room was not acceptable. We were shown to our new room which was the same size as the first one. We quickly unpacked a few things and ordered an Uber to go to our dinner reservation in the Financial District. As we waited for the elevator to arrive, the same hotel associate reappeared and to our surprise, he said that his manager had approved an upgrade for us (we had not expressed our interest in one) to make up for their mistake with our first room. We were already running late to our dinner reservation so we accepted the upgrade as well as his offer to move our belongings to the new room.
The new room was slightly larger and had a gorgeous view of Central Park. However, I did find the room to be rather outdated in its design. Additionally, the bathroom was outfitted with a bathtub/shower combo and the bathtub was very high. At seven months pregnant, it was difficult for me to step in and out of the bathtub. There was no fan in the bathroom, resulting in the bathroom getting rather foggy and steamy when showering.
The TV responded quite slowly to the remote and did not have such a great selection of channels.
Lastly, throughout the night we were able to hear noise from the street below and it disturbed our sleep.
When it was time to check out the following day, the hotel associate at the front desk offered to email me the receipt for our stay. Once in the car and on our way, I opened the email and found that we were charged a $382 room change charge as well as $95 oversized car valet charge (the car in question is a 2016 Honda Pilot). I immediately called the front desk to dispute the room change charge and after much back and forth they agreed to refund the $382.
From all the glitches and lack of professionalism displayed by this hotel, I would not return or recommend this hotel to anyone. I sincerely hope that the category 8 Marriott hotels reopen soon.

I truly loved my experience at the JW Marriott Essex House. The staff are amazing, and have an obvious commitment to customer service, assisting in celebrating a special occasion!

The hotel is a beautiful art-deco structure, in a prime location on Central Park. It’s very close to Times Square, and subway stations.
The lobby was large and clean, with a throwback style, and helpful staff. Check in was a breeze, with my bags being taken up to my room for us as our room wasn’t quite ready.

We spent two nights in a Manhattan view suite, which was an amazing room. The room was huge, with an amazing large terrace with great views of the Manhattan skyline, including some of the biggest buildings. The living area included a separate sitting area, a desk, and a large sectional couch. The bathroom was large, spacious and modern, with a separate shower / soaker tub.

The separate bedroom was also large, with a very comfortable bed, and great views. We used the fitness centre twice, which had a great selection of equipment, including a peloton, and plenty of water! The restaurant was fast, and tasted great, and although I felt maybe the drinks were a bit overpriced, the $35 daily credit offset it. Platinum status meant access to the lounge, and Breakfast there was plentiful, fresh and tasted great.

All the staff were very friendly and genuinely interested in helping. I left something down in the gym, and called to see if anyone turned it in, and within 2 minute it was at my door.

I will definitely return, and in fact, won’t be staying anywhere else in Manhattan.
